Beer Bread

In my attempt to ignore the pile of laundry and the gifts that needed to be wrapped the week before Christmas, I came across a great recipe for Beer Bread while searching the web.  I love that you can take one simple recipe and add different herbs, cheeses and liquid for a unique taste each time.  I have made this three times in the last three weeks.  It stirs up quick and the leftovers are super warmed and slathered with butter!  (Not that I would know that from experience!)

The first time I made it was with dill and cheddar as suggested with a good 'ole Bud Light.  The second time I made it with garlic powder, shredded taco cheese and a lime beer (can't remember the brand).  Last night I left out the cheese and added dried onion and parsley with a Bud Light.  My favorite was the garlic powder/taco cheese/lime beer combo.  I would really like to try it with a can of ginger ale or cream soda for a sweet twist.
